Worksheet Description

This worksheet is a learning tool that introduces students to the concept of multiplication as repeated addition. It provides a table with columns labeled “Equal Groups,” “Repeated Addition,” “Array,” and “Multiplication Sentence.” Students are tasked with identifying the pattern of equal groups, writing out the corresponding repeated addition equation, observing the visual array representation, and finally formulating a multiplication sentence. The worksheet includes pictorial examples and partially completed rows that the students need to fill in, using the provided visual cues.

The purpose of the worksheet is to help students make connections between different representations of multiplication. It encourages the recognition of patterns in equal groups and translates them into both repeated addition statements and multiplication sentences. By completing the table, students learn to visualize multiplication as an array, thereby strengthening their understanding of the operation. The worksheet aims to build foundational skills in multiplication by showing that it is a more efficient way to combine equal groups than repeated addition.
